Note that in UK English, if you start with Dear Sir or Dear Madam, you should end with Yours faithfully.But if you use the person’s name, you should end with Yours sincerely.This rule may seem arbitrary, but it is one of the rules of formal letter writing that is widely known in the UK; therefore I recommend you stick to it. The conventions for closing business emails vary, but phrases such as the following are appropriate: Regards, Kind regards, Best regards, With kind regards, In business emails, you should also include your full name, organisation, and contact details at the end.
